About this route:
A direct, nonstop flight between Ipil Airport (IPE), Ipil, Zamboanga Sibugay, Philippines and Monroe County Airport (BMG), Bloomington, Indiana, United States would travel a Great Circle distance of 8,693 miles (or 13,989 kilometers).
A Great Circle is the shortest distance between 2 points on a sphere. Because most world maps are flat (but the Earth is round), the route of the shortest distance between 2 points on the Earth will often appear curved when viewed on a flat map, especially for long distances. If you were to simply draw a straight line on a flat map and measure a very long distance, it would likely be much further than if you were to lay a string between those two points on a globe. Because of the large distance between Ipil Airport and Monroe County Airport, the route shown on this map most likely appears curved because of this reason.

Facts about Ipil Airport (IPE):
- The closest airport to Ipil Airport (IPE) is Pagadian Airport (PAG), which is located 59 miles (95 kilometers) E of IPE.
- In addition to being known as "Ipil Airport", another name for IPE is "Paliparan ng Ipil Tugpahanan sa Ipil Aeropuerto de Ipil".
- The furthest airport from Ipil Airport (IPE) is Piloto Osvaldo Marques Dias Airport (AFL), which is nearly antipodal to Ipil Airport (meaning Ipil Airport is almost on the exact opposite side of the Earth from Piloto Osvaldo Marques Dias Airport), and is located 12,268 miles (19,744 kilometers) away in Alta Floresta, Brazil.
- Because of Ipil Airport's relatively low elevation of 52 feet, planes can take off or land at Ipil Airport at a lower air speed than at airports located at a higher elevation. This is because the air density is higher closer to sea level than it would otherwise be at higher elevations.
- Ipil Airport (IPE) currently has only 1 runway.
Facts about Monroe County Airport (BMG):
- Monroe County Airport (BMG) has 2 runways.
- The furthest airport from Monroe County Airport (BMG) is Margaret River Airport (MGV), which is located 11,182 miles (17,996 kilometers) away in Margaret River, Western Australia, Australia.
- The closest airport to Monroe County Airport (BMG) is Virgil I. Grissom Municipal Airport (BFR), which is located 23 miles (37 kilometers) SSE of BMG.
- Commercial carriers offered scheduled service to and from Monroe County Airport until the late 1990s.
- Because of Monroe County Airport's relatively low elevation of 846 feet, planes can take off or land at Monroe County Airport at a lower air speed than at airports located at a higher elevation. This is because the air density is higher closer to sea level than it would otherwise be at higher elevations.
